Output 531b9a536f7bba7c8ab23d244fb9075d1e920bc0bab2b20bec5acaf261419eed:1

value
31429739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8089332b73d751a333a54798b205d7ac58e8d262 OP_EQUAL
address
3DQemuuSBX2dq1p5JsnKqX3w33Awg8So3m
transaction
531b9a536f7bba7c8ab23d244fb9075d1e920bc0bab2b20bec5acaf261419eed
spent
true